Factors to Consider When Choosing a Therapist in Enterprise

Finding the right psychiatrist in Enterprise, Alabama, starts with understanding the type of care you need. Psychiatrists are medical doctors who can diagnose mental health conditions, prescribe medication, and manage ongoing medication plans. Psychiatric nurse practitioners (PMHNPs) can also prescribe and manage medication. If you're looking for support with anxiety, depression, ADHD, bipolar disorder, PTSD, or medication management, a psychiatric provider may be the right fit.

Enterprise is a smaller market, so the number of local psychiatric providers may be limited compared to larger Alabama cities. Virtual psychiatry appointments can expand your options significantly — connecting you with licensed providers across the state from home. When evaluating providers, consider their experience with your specific concerns, whether they offer virtual or in-person sessions, and how their approach aligns with your goals. Reading a provider's bio can help you understand their style before you commit.

Psychiatry in Alabama can be costly without insurance coverage. Using your in-network benefits is one of the most reliable ways to reduce what you pay out of pocket.
